我正在尝试使用 VS 2013 在 Windows 上构建 Open SSL,并支持 ZLIB。
我按照这种方式操作: perl Configure VC-WIN32 --prefix="D:\work_local\openssl\openssl-1.0.1h\redist" no-asm zlib no-shared
ms\do_ms
nmake -f ms\ntdll.mak
现在我收到链接器错误,说没有找到 zlib1.lib。
令人惊讶的是,它并没有抱怨找不到 zlib.h。
那么如何在 Windows 上构建 OpenSSL 时传递 ZLIB 包含和 LIB 路径?
我已经构建了一个非常基本的EXE,它使用Websocketpp客户端,它只连接到Websocket服务器,并发送和接收消息.我用过VS 2013.
我注意到EXE的大小是巨大的.它类似于2.3 MB的Release和6 MB的Debug.
关于如何减小EXE大小的任何想法?